As the industry leader in water technology, we’re growing and need talented people like you to help us continue to protect the world’s most vital resource. Nalco Water, an Ecolab Company, seeks a Technical Sales Representative to join its industry leading sales team. You’ll be responsible for revenue and profit growth of programs and services in targeted accounts. Using a consultative sales approach, you’ll build relationships with existing customers by executing system assurance programs that meet their key business needs. With strong account leadership, you’ll also convert strategic competitive accounts and sell new technologies to current customers.

What You Will Do

  • Execute strong team leadership by coaching and training other District Reps, championing corporate initiatives, and planning and leading portions of District Meetings
  • Generate and execute sales plans and strategies to close new opportunities within existing customer base, and in major, competitively-held accounts, to meet defined territory profit increase goals.
  • Work closely with large, strategic current and prospective customers to understand business needs and recommend continuous improvement and innovation plans that will maintain and grow sales within assigned territory
  • Develop strong relationships with key stakeholders within current and prospective customers, including plant or facility executives
  • Engage in problem solving by performing system analysis, interpreting data and providing written recommendations to ensure customer operations are performing at optimal levels
  • Demonstrate the ability to stabilize jeopardy business in large, strategic accounts

Territory/Location Information

  • This position is based in Devon / Somerset
  • Territory covers the south west area
  • Targeted accounts are within the food, beverage, light manufacturing industries
  • Occasional overnight travel required
  • Training programs are held in the field and at Nalco Water Headquarters in Leiden; travel is arranged and paid for by Nalco Water.

Minimum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ree
  • Five years of technical sales or field sales support experience
  • Possess a valid Driver's License and acceptable Motor Vehicle Record
  • Immigration sponsorship is not available for this role

Preferred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in engineering (chemical, mechanical, industrial) or life sciences (biology, chemistry, etc.)
  • Water treatment or specialty chemical industry experience
  • Working knowledge of boilers, cooling towers, and wastewater treatment systems
